Panduan Lengkap Pembinaan Laman Web dengan WordPress: Proses dan Teknologi dari Awal Hingga Mahir

Baca dalam masa 2 minit.
2026-04-14
2026-06-03
2,842
Saya mendapat komisen apabila anda membeli-belah melalui pautan di bawah, tanpa sebarang kos tambahan kepada anda.

Tahap Persiapan: Nama domain, pelayan (host) dan konfigurasi persekitaran

Langkah pertama dalam memulakan sebuah laman web WordPress dengan jayanya adalah dengan melakukan persiapan yang menyeluruh terlebih dahulu. Fasa ini menentukan sama ada asas laman web tersebut kukuh atau tidak, dan secara langsung mempengaruhi pengalaman pembangunan yang seterusnya, prestasi laman web, serta keselamatannya.

Pemilihan dan pembelian elemen-elemen teras

Anda perlu membeli sebuah nama domain dan sebuah pelayan (host) yang boleh dipercayai. Nama domain merupakan alamat laman web, dan ia seharusnya ringkas, mudah diingat serta berkaitan dengan tema laman web tersebut. Pelayan (seperti pelayan maya, VPS, atau server awan) merupakan “rumah” bagi laman web. Bagi pemula dan kebanyakan laman web bersaiz kecil hingga sederhana, pelayan WordPress yang disertakan dengan ciri pengurusan (managed WordPress hosting) merupakan pilihan yang ideal, kerana ia biasanya sudah dipasang dengan persekitaran yang dioptimumkan, fungsi sandaran automatik, dan ciri keselamatan. Jika anda memilih untuk mengurus pelayan sendiri (seperti VPS), anda perlu mengkonfigurasi persekitaran LAMP (Linux, Apache, MySQL, PHP) atau LEMP (Linux, Nginx, MySQL, PHP) sendiri.

Pembinaan persekitaran pembangunan tempatan

Membina sebuah persekitaran ujian yang serupa dengan persekitaran dalam talian pada komputer lokal adalah sangat penting. Ini membolehkan anda mengembangkan dan menguji tema serta plugin tanpa mempengaruhi laman web dalam talian. Alat pembangunan lokal yang popular termasuk Local by Flywheel, XAMPP, dan MAMP. Alat-alat ini membenarkan anda memasang dan mengkonfigurasi PHP, MySQL, dan pelayan web dengan mudah dengan satu klik sahaja. Sebagai contoh, selepas memasang Local, anda boleh membuat beberapa laman web lokal, dan setiap laman web tersebut mempunyai nama domain yang berasingan.yoursite.localIa bergabung dengan pangkalan data, yang sangat memudahkan proses pembangunan.

Diperoleh daripada WEB\nDisyorkan untuk membaca. Pembangunan Tema WordPress: Panduan Lengkap dari Permulaan hingga Kemahiran Tinggi dan Teknik Praktikal

Pemasangan dan Konfigurasi Asas

Setelah selesai persiapan yang diperlukan, anda boleh meneruskan ke langkah pemasangan dan pengaturan awal WordPress.

UltaHost – Penyedia Hosting untuk WordPress
Jaminan pemulangan wang dalam tempoh 30 hari, lebar jalur dan pangkalan data yang tidak terhad, perlindungan DDoS percuma, diskaun 50% untuk pembelian selama 3 tahun.

Proses pemasangan standard

Kebanyakan penyedia hos yang bereputasi menawarkan fungsi “Pemasangan WordPress dengan satu klik”. Anda hanya perlu mencari alat seperti “Softaculous” atau “WordPress Manager” dalam panel kawalan hos (seperti cPanel), mengisi maklumat laman web mengikut arahan panduan (nama pangkalan data, nama pengguna, akaun pentadbir, dll.), dan pemasangan akan selesai dalam beberapa minit sahaja. Bagi pemasangan manual, anda perlu memuat turun paket pemasangan terkini dari laman web rasmi WordPress.org, dan mengunggahkannya ke direktori akar hos melalui FTP.public_htmlwwwBuka folder tersebut, kemudian kunjungi domain name anda dalam pelayar web, dan ikuti arahan panduan “Pemasangan dalam Lima Minit” yang terkenal tersebut.

Pengaturan awal yang kritikal

Setelah pemasangan berjaya, semasa log masuk ke bahagian pentadbiran untuk kali pertama (biasanya...yoursite.com/wp-adminUntuk itu, anda harus mengakses terlebih dahulu…“设置”Konfigurasikan menu seperti berikut:
Di “常规”Dalam proses pengaturan, pastikan anda mengisi “Alamat WordPress” dan “Alamat Laman Web” dengan betul, serta menetapkan zon masa yang sesuai.“固定链接”Dalam proses pengaturan, disyorkan untuk memilih “Nama Artikel” atau “Struktur Custom” (seperti…)/%postname%/Ini membantu menghasilkan struktur URL yang mesra enjin carian, dan ia harus ditentukan sebelum laman web diterbitkan, kerana perubahan kemudian boleh menyebabkan pautan asal tidak berfungsi. Pada masa yang sama, artikel “Hello World” lalai dan halaman contoh perlu dihapuskan.

Pembangunan dan Penyesuaian Tema

Tema menentukan penampilan dan susun atur laman web. Anda boleh memilih daripada ribuan tema yang tersedia, sama ada yang percuma atau berbayar, atau anda boleh membuat penyesuaian yang lebih mendalam atau mengembangkan tema tersebut sendiri.

Amalan Pembangunan Subtopik

Mengubah fail tema induk secara langsung adalah amalan yang berbahaya, kerana kemas kini tema akan menimpa semua perubahan yang telah dibuat. Cara yang betul adalah dengan membuat tema anak (sub-theme). Buatlah folder baru, contohnya dengan nama…twentytwentyfive-childDalamnya, buat satu.style.cssFail tersebut harus mempunyai kepala fail (file header) yang mengandungi maklumat tertentu untuk menyatakan kaitannya dengan topik induk (parent topic).

Diperoleh daripada WEB\nDisyorkan untuk membaca. Apa itu pelayan bersama (shared hosting)? Panduan profesional ini akan membantu anda memahami dengan cepat kelebihan dan kekangan pelayan bersama.

/*
 Theme Name:   Twenty Twenty-Five Child
 Theme URI:    http://example.com/twenty-twenty-five-child/
 Description:  Twenty Twenty-Five Child Theme
 Author:       Your Name
 Author URI:   http://example.com
 Template:     twentytwentyfive
 Version:      1.0.0
 Text Domain:  twentytwentyfive-child
*/

Kemudian, buat satu folder dalam folder sub-topik tersebut.functions.phpFail ini digunakan untuk memuatkan fail gaya tema induk dengan selamat dan menambahkan ciri-ciri khusus yang dibangunkan sendiri.

<?php
add_action( 'wp_enqueue_scripts', 'my_child_theme_enqueue_styles' );
function my_child_theme_enqueue_styles() {
    wp_enqueue_style( 'parent-style', get_template_directory_uri() . '/style.css' );
}
?>

Penggunaan fail templat dan hook

Tema WordPress terdiri daripada satu siri fail templat. Sebagai contoh,single.phpKawalan penampilan artikel tunggal.page.phpKawalan penampilan halaman tunggal.header.phpIni adalah bahagian atas laman web (header). Anda boleh menyesuaikan mana-mana halaman dengan menyalin fail templat daripada tema induk ke tema anak dan membuat pengubahsuaian yang diperlukan. Pada masa yang sama, anda juga boleh menggunakan “action hooks” untuk memanfaatkan fungsi tambahan dalam laman web tersebut.add_actionAnd filter hooksapply_filtersFungsi-fungsi boleh ditambahkan atau diubah tanpa perlu mengubah fail-fail asas. Sebagai contoh, teks boleh ditambah secara automatik di akhir kandungan artikel.

add_filter( 'the_content', 'my_content_filter' );
function my_content_filter( $content ) {
    if ( is_single() ) {
        $content .= '<p>Terima kasih kerana membaca artikel ini!</p>';
    }
    return $content;
}

Pembesaran Fungsi dan Keselamatan Prestasi

Plugin adalah modul yang digunakan untuk memperluas fungsi WordPress, tetapi perlu digunakan dengan berhati-hati. Penggunaan yang tidak sesuai boleh memberi kesan negatif yang serius terhadap kelajuan dan keselamatan laman web.

hosting.com Hosting Bersama
Prestasi tinggi, menampilkan CPU AMD EPYC, storan SSD NVMe dan LiteSpeed, dengan sokongan pakar dalaman 24/7, langkah keselamatan canggih termasuk SSL, perlindungan serangan paksa kata laluan, perisian hasad dan DDoS, menjimatkan sehingga 73%.

Pemilihan dan Pengurusan Plugin

Ketika memilih plugin, anda harus memberi keutamaan kepada plugin yang mempunyai skor yang tinggi di repositori rasmi, aktif digunakan, baru diperbaharui, dan mendapat sokongan yang baik daripada pembangunnya. Kategori plugin yang wajib dipasang termasuk: plugin caching (seperti WP Rocket, W3 Total Cache), plugin keselamatan (seperti Wordfence, iThemes Security), plugin SEO (seperti Yoast SEO, Rank Math), dan plugin sandaran (seperti UpdraftPlus). Pentadbir laman web harus mengemas kini versi terkini WordPress core, semua plugin, dan tema secara berkala, kerana ini merupakan salah satu langkah keselamatan yang paling penting.

Langkah-langkah kritikal untuk pengoptimuman prestasi

Inti dari pengoptimuman prestasi adalah penggunaan cache (kumpulan data yang disimpan sementara) dan pengoptimuman sumber daya. Plugin cache dapat menghasilkan fail HTML yang statik, yang dengan ketara mengurangkan beban pada pelayan. Pada masa yang sama, imej-imej perlu dioptimumkan (gunakan format WebP, lakukan pengunduhan secara beransur-ansur), dan fail CSS serta JavaScript perlu digabungkan serta dikurangkan saiznya menggunakan plugin yang sesuai. Penggunaan rangkaian pengedaran kandungan (Content Distribution Network/CDN) dapat mempercepatkan kelajuan akses bagi pengguna di seluruh dunia.functions.phpDalam proses tersebut, skrip yang tidak diperlukan boleh dikeluarkan, dan penggunaan beberapa gaya (styles) dari perpustakaan Gutenberg boleh dihalang untuk mengurangkan saiz fail sumber (resources).

Tindakan pengukuhan keselamatan.

Selain menggunakan tambahan keselamatan untuk mengatur pengaturcaraan firewall dan mengimbas perisian berbahaya, beberapa langkah pengukuhan asas juga perlu dilaksanakan: ubah alamat log masuk lalai.wp-adminwp-login.php(Ia boleh dilaksanakan melalui plugin keselamatan atau kod); Memaksa semua pengguna untuk menggunakan kata laluan yang kuat; Mengganti awalan jadual pangkalan data secara berkala (dilakukan semasa pemasangan, atau kemudian melalui pengubahsuaian menggunakan plugin); Melalui.htaccessHad penggunaan fail (file usage restrictions)wp-config.phpAkses kepada dokumen-dokumen penting seperti ini.

Diperoleh daripada WEB\nDisyorkan untuk membaca. Cara Memilih dan Menyesuaikan Tema WordPress Anda: Dari Pemula Hingga Pakar

RINGKASAN

Panduan ini merangkum secara sistematik proses pembinaan sebuah laman web WordPress yang profesional bermula dari awal. Bermula dari persiapan nama domain dan pilihan hos, pemasangan serta pengaturan awal, hingga ke pengembangan yang lebih mendalam melalui penggunaan subtema dan fungsi “hook”, seterusnya kepada peningkatan prestasi dan pengukuhan keselamatan melalui plugin serta kod sumber. Setiap langkah dalam proses ini saling berkaitan. Kejayaan sebuah projek WordPress bukan sahaja bergantung pada pelaksanaan fungsi-fungsi yang diinginkan, tetapi juga pada pembinaan asas digital yang stabil, cepat, dan selamat. Dengan menguasai proses dan teknik-teknik teras ini, anda akan dapat mengendalikan WordPress dengan yakin dan mengubahnya menjadi platform yang kuat yang dapat memenuhi sebarang keperluan.

FAQ - Soalan Lazim

Bagaimana untuk mengubah alamat log masuk laman web untuk meningkatkan keselamatan?

Mengubah alamat log masuk dapat membantu mencegah serangan kejam (brute force attacks) terhadap halaman log masuk lalai. Anda boleh melakukannya dengan mudah menggunakan tambahan keselamatan seperti WPS Hide Login, yang menyediakan antara muka pengaturan untuk membolehkan anda menyesuaikan URL log masuk. Jika anda ingin melakukannya melalui kod, anda perlu menambahkan kod yang berkaitan ke dalam tema anak (sub-theme).functions.phpDalam fail tersebut, peraturan-peraturan tersebut ditulis semula (misalnya, dengan membuat pengubahsuaian)..htaccessFail tersebut digunakan untuk menyembunyikan alamat asal, namun penyelesaian berbentuk plugin adalah lebih selamat dan mudah untuk digunakan.

Hosting Bersama InterServer
Hosting kongsi: 1TB/bulan pada $2.50 USD, bulan pertama pada $0.10 USD dengan kod promo tryinterserver. 461 skrip aplikasi awan tersedia untuk pemasangan satu klik.

Adakah pembuatan sub-topik merupakan sesuatu yang wajib? Apakah risiko jika kita membuat perubahan terus pada topik utama (parent topic)?

Untuk sebarang pengubahsuaian yang disesuaikan, sangat disyorkan untuk menggunakan subtema. Jangan membuat pengubahsuaian terus pada fail tema induk (parent theme file).style.cssfunctions.phpRisiko menggunakan subtema (atau sebarang fail templat) adalah apabila versi baru tema induk dikeluarkan dan diperbaharui, semua pengubahsuaian yang anda buat akan ditolak sepenuhnya, yang boleh menyebabkan reka letak laman web menjadi kacau atau fungsi-fungsi tidak berfungsi dengan betul. Dengan menggunakan subtema, kod yang anda buat sendiri dapat dipisahkan daripada kod asas tema induk, memastikan bahawa gaya dan fungsi unik anda dapat dikekalkan walaupun tema induk diperbaharui untuk tujuan keselamatan.

Laman web berjalan dengan sangat perlahan; dari aspek manakah kita harus mula menyiasat dan mengoptimumkannya?

Kelajuan laman web yang perlahan biasanya disebabkan oleh beberapa faktor. Adalah disyorkan untuk menyiasat masalah tersebut mengikut urutan berikut: Pertama, gunakan alat seperti GTmetrix atau PageSpeed Insights untuk menghasilkan laporan yang menjelaskan masalah yang terdapat. Kemudian, laksanakan pengoptimuman penting berikut: Pasang dan konfigurasi plugin caching yang berkesan; Kompres dan optimalkan format semua gambar (tukar kepada format WebP); Aktifkan kompresi GZIP; Bersihkan dan minimalkan fail CSS dan JavaScript; Pertimbangkan untuk menggunakan CDN untuk mempercepatkan sumber statik; Semak dan matikan plugin yang tidak perlu atau yang mempunyai prestasi yang rendah; Akhir sekali, jika boleh, naik taraf kepada penyelesaian hos yang lebih berprestasi (seperti VPS atau pelayan khusus).

Bagaimana untuk memindahkan laman web dari persekitaran pembangunan tempatan ke hos rasmi atas talian?

Mengembara laman web memerlukan pemindahan fail dan pangkalan data. Ia disyorkan untuk menggunakan alat migrasi yang profesional (seperti All-in-One WP Migration, Duplicator), yang boleh menguruskan proses penggantian data yang telah diseriakan secara automatik. Langkah-langkah migrasi secara manual adalah seperti berikut: Pertama, eksport seluruh pangkalan data laman web tempatan menggunakan phpMyAdmin. Kemudian, gunakan klien FTP untuk memuat naik semua fail laman web ke direktori akar pelayan web atas talian. Selepas itu, buat pangkalan data baru di pelayan web atas talian dan import data yang telah dieksport tadi. Akhir sekali, ubah tetapan laman web tersebut di pelayan web atas talian.wp-config.phpMaklumat sambungan pangkalan data dalam fail tersebut digunakan, dan skrip atau plugin “Cari & Ganti” digunakan untuk mengemas kini semua alamat web tempatan yang lama dalam pangkalan data dengan domain nama dalam talian yang baru dengan selamat.